‘Come on, let’s go~’ Tottenham aiming for Sporting RB, set a date for negotiations

Tottenham Hotspur have set a negotiation date for the signing of Pedro Poro (Sporting CP).

Britain’s ‘Sports Witness’ said on the 13th (Korean time), “Tottenham wants to strengthen their squad through the January transfer market. One of the positions they want to reinforce is right wingback. A meeting between the clubs is scheduled for the week.”

The transfer market opened in January, and Tottenham started scouting the right wingback. The reason is clear. This is because Emerson Royal, Matt Doherty, and Jed Spence, who are out this season, are below expectations. Left and right wingbacks are the most important positions in Antonio Conte’s football plan. On the left, Ivan Perisic and Ryan Sessegnon played a part, while on the right, it was a disaster.

In response, manager Conte picked ‘right wingback’ as a task for the January transfer market. Previously, the British ‘Evening Standard’ said, “Coach Conte has made recruiting a new right wingback his top priority this month. He was not sure about Doherty and Emerson.”

The sale that Tottenham is currently chasing is a prisoner of Sporting. Spanish right-back Poro is 23 years old and belongs to the young axis. He had a lot of advantages there. It distributes accurately regardless of running cross or early cross. In addition, his focus is also on the fast side, and he is very consistent with the type of coach Conte wants, such as penetrating directly into the penalty box and looking for an opportunity to score.

Tottenham are now planning to negotiate directly with Sporting. The time is next week. Tottenham have a north London derby against Arsenal at the weekend, while Sporting travel to Benfica. Since we had an important match ahead, we decided to set it up for next week.

What needs to be solved is the transfer fee. Sporting are sticking to the 45 million euro (approximately 60 billion won) buyout of POW. The shoulders of the Tottenham negotiators were heavy.

There is confidence in personal agreement. According to the media, Tottenham promised the prisoner more than twice the current weekly wage. Some say that they have already reached an individual agreement. It is only necessary to narrow the differences between clubs.
